The journalling reads: Before 1791, Catholicism was illegal in Ireland, so my ancestors were forced to worship in secret. The locals of the Coollattin estate chose this boulder, which was deep in an oak forest at that time, to be their altar. They made their way on foot to Mass Rock to celebrate their faith each Sunday, rain or shine. On July 19, 2018, we Canadian descendants of Coollattin and many of the people of Tinahely joined together at Mass Rock in a prayer of thanks to God and in praise of our ancestors for their courage, which allowed each of us to be. It was a profoundly moving moment when Father Brendan led us in prayer, and when Ann-Marie Connolly (Keogh) sang the haunting As I Leave Behind Néidin, we vowed always to remember this day and these people.
